Engine oil
Gener
al notes
Fig. 288
In the engine compartment: engine
oil l
abel
Fig. 289
In the engine compartment: area
wher
e the engine oil label is located
Key to the
Fig. 288:
Information about the engine oil stand-
ard.
Information about engine oil viscosity.
A
B
The engine comes with a special, multi-grade
oil that can be used all year r
ound.
Because the use of high-quality oil is essen-
tial for the correct operation of the engine
and its long useful life, when topping up or
changing oil, use only those oils that comply
with VW standards.
For vehicles with an engine oil label
If the engine oil has to be topped up, use one
of the oils shown on the label
››
Fig. 288. The
label with the prescribed standard is located
at the front of the engine compartment
››
Fig. 289
1
. If you use the recommended
engine oil, you can t
op up the oil as often as
necessary.
For vehicles without an engine oil label
Contact a specialised workshop or SEAT offi-
cial service for information about the corre-
sponding standard.
If the engine oil level is too low
If the recommended engine oil is not availa-
ble, in the event of an emergency you can
change the oil once with a maximum of 0.5 L
of the next oil until the next oil change:
Petrol and CNG engines: VW 504 00,
ACEA C3 or API SN standard.
Diesel engines: VW 507 00, ACEA C3 or
API CJ-4, viscosity 0W-30.
